Education in Catalonia

The results of a piece of research carried out by the Fundació Jaume Bofill show that 14% 4th ESO Catalan students are in fact repeat students. This percentage leaves Catalonia at the end of secondary education statistics in Spain, which is only worse in Extremadura and the Canary Islands. When asking 24 year-olds, 34% answered they stopped going to school after finishing the ESO. This figure is one of the worst in Europe, where only Portugal and Malta have higher percentages.
